Features of PP Woven Bag Processing

1. Durability and Strength
PP woven bags are renowned for their exceptional tensile strength and load-bearing capacity. The polypropylene material provides superior resistance to tearing, stretching, and impact, making these bags ideal for heavy-duty packaging applications. They can safely transport bulk materials weighing up to 50-100 kilograms without structural compromise.
2. Weather Resistance and Longevity
All series of PP woven bags are manufactured with UV-stabilized formulas, ensuring color permanence and preventing material degradation under prolonged sun exposure. The woven structure resists moisture absorption, preventing mould growth and maintaining product integrity during outdoor storage and transportation.
3. Chemical Resistance
PP woven bags demonstrate excellent resistance to acids, alkalis, salts, and most organic solvents. This chemical inertness makes them suitable for packaging fertilizers, chemicals, and industrial materials without risk of container deterioration or content contamination.
4. Lightweight and Cost-Effective Transportation
PP woven bags are remarkably lightweight compared to traditional packaging materials like jute or cotton. This characteristic significantly reduces shipping costs and facilitates easy manual handling during loading, unloading, and stacking operations.
5. Versatile Processing and Customization
PP woven bags can be manufactured using standard extrusion and weaving equipment. The material allows for cutting, sewing, printing, and laminating processes. They can be customized with various specifications including different dimensions, weights, colors, and printing designs to meet specific branding requirements.
6. Breathability and Moisture Control
The woven structure provides natural ventilation, preventing moisture buildup and condensation inside the bag. This feature is particularly valuable for agricultural products requiring air circulation, such as grains, seeds, and fresh produce.
7. Eco-Friendly and Recyclable
PP woven bags are 100% recyclable and can be reprocessed into new plastic products. Their durability enables multiple reuse cycles, reducing overall packaging waste and supporting sustainable logistics operations.
8. Lamination and Coating Compatibility
PP woven bags readily accept additional surface treatments including BOPP lamination, PE coating, and anti-slip finishes. These enhancements improve moisture barrier properties, print quality, and stacking stability for specialized applications.
9. Food Safety Compliance
Food-grade PP woven bags meet international safety standards for direct food contact. They are widely used for packaging rice, flour, sugar, and animal feed without risk of toxic migration or odor contamination.
10. Anti-Skid and Stackability
The woven texture provides natural friction properties that prevent slippage during palletization and warehouse storage. Bags maintain stable stacking configurations, optimizing space utilization and reducing handling accidents.
